Put in
verb
Word Frequency:
21.8
Definitions
1.
verb
To place inside.
"Just put in the key for the ignition and turn it."
2.
verb
To apply, request, or submit.
"I'm going to the bank to put in for a transfer."
3.
verb
To contribute.
"Despite his success, the comedian liked to put in appearances at some of the smaller venues."
4.
verb
To call at (a place or port), especially as a deviation from an intended journey.
